Home » Islam Awazi

Category Archives: Islam Awazi

Turkish Translation of video release from Ḥizb al-Islāmī al-Turkistānī [Turkestan Islamic Party]: “Lovers of Paradise #5″

NOTE: The Arabic version was originally released on December 28, 2010, which you can watch here. For previous videos see #3 and #4.


Source: http://www.aljahad.com/vb/showthread.php?t=4538


Get every new post delivered to your Inbox.

Join 5,168 other followers

%d bloggers like this: